Q: What is ProfitProject’s value proposition and how does the company differentiate from competitors?

A: Our value lies in providing advanced software that enables organizations to manage their operations more efficiently. The original concept was to create a tool that could display all business indicators in a single interface, similar to the simplicity and engagement of a video game dashboard. Over time, this evolved into a robust enterprise platform used across critical sectors, including government, healthcare, energy, defense, and education. Unlike traditional solutions, our product is highly adaptable, empowering clients to modify and scale it independently without vendor dependency.

Q: What are your objectives for the Mexican market?  

A: Our goal in Mexico is not to increase our workload, but to establish a hub for innovation and development through local partnerships. We work with regional integrators who implement our systems in accordance with local market needs. We aim to understand what Mexican organizations value, what solutions they are willing to adopt, and to identify strategic partners who can localize our technology effectively.

Mexican companies have shown professionalism and precision. During one-on-one meetings, every question was highly specific and purposeful, reflecting the seriousness of potential clients. Mexican professionals have also proven approachable, which reinforces the potential for building strong partnerships in this market.

Q: Which sectors stand to benefit the most from your solutions?

A: Our platform is sector-agnostic and has been successfully applied across industries in Russia, from logistics to energy, aviation, and education. Its core strength is adaptability, allowing organizations to configure the system according to their own operational needs. While we do not target a single vertical, our technology has demonstrated a particularly strong impact in the education sector.

Q: What benefits have your solutions brought to the education sector?

A: In education, our platform enables university leadership to align faculty performance with institutional objectives through measurable KPIs. While professors are often regarded as individual “stars,” it is challenging to translate their work into collective progress. Our system allows deans to cascade annual academic goals into concrete targets, track them quarterly, and identify gaps early. This transparency reduces subjectivity, strengthens accountability, and supports evidence-based decision-making, ultimately elevating institutional performance over a two to three-year cycle.

Q: How does your system improve transparency and fairness in performance evaluations?

A: Our platform eliminates subjectivity by ensuring that everyone within the institution, from professors to deans, works with the same data. Performance is measured through clear KPIs, enabling recognition and rewards to be based on objective results rather than personal preferences. This creates a culture of accountability and fairness, while also making progress fully visible and measurable across all organizational levels.

Q: What are your long-term goals in Mexico?

A: Our primary objective is to establish a competence center in Mexico that can serve as a hub for Spanish-speaking countries across the Americas. Mexico offers cultural and organizational similarities that make it a strategic base for regional expansion. To achieve this, we aim to identify reliable local partners who can support implementation and growth, given that our company remains relatively small and our specialists are already highly loaded with work.

ProfitProject develops adaptive software that improves efficiency and accountability across sectors such as healthcare, education, and government. With a team of 50 specialists, the company is expanding to Mexico to build a regional hub for innovation and partnerships.
